Output cba5ad6866e61af50497e11e1bb5dc379594326f6dbac2195b9a943badda18c6:25

value
21730687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a97cdafa4a855c063f8e71c19008fd0ce4188b4 OP_EQUAL
address
MEha67dG5ALVzoFgFYSX5Q6YFpsSnLkszf
transaction
cba5ad6866e61af50497e11e1bb5dc379594326f6dbac2195b9a943badda18c6
spent
true